1.  NITI AAYOG AND THE NETHERLANDS SIGNED SOI

    India is committed to reduce carbon emissions’ intensity by 33%–35% by 2030 and for this nation is collaborating internationally to achieve the ambitious sustainable targets.

    In this regard, a Statement of Intent (SoI) was inked between NITI (National Institution for Transforming India) Aayog and Embassy of the Netherlands in New Delhi, to combine the expertise of both nations (Indo-Dutch) in supporting the decarbonization and energy transition agenda for accommodating cleaner and more energy.

    It was signed by NITI Aayog Chief Executive Officer (CEO) Amitabh Kant and Ambassador of the Netherlands to India Marten van den Berg.

 

2.  “AMBEDKAR SOCIAL INNOVATION & INCUBATION MISSION (ASIIM)”

  Union Minister for Social Justice & Empowerment, Thaawarchand Gehlot virtually launched “Ambedkar Social Innovation & Incubation Mission (ASIIM)” under Venture Capital Fund for Scheduled Castes (SC)(VCF-SC).

  It has been launched to promote innovation, enterprise among SC students in Higher Education Institutions and to help them become Job Givers.

  Minister of State (MoS) for Social Justice & Empowerment, Rattan Lal Kataria,

  Deputy Managing Director (MD) of Industrial Finance Corporation of India (IFCI), Sunil Kumar Bansal were present during the launch.

 

3. UN GENERAL ASSEMBLY – 75TH SESSION

  The 75th session of the United Nations General Assembly (UNGA 75) was held virtually for the first time amid COVID -19.

  It was hosted by the United States of America (USA) from New York and under the Presidency of Volkan Bozkir of Turkey.

  During the session, a special event was organized on September 21, 2020 marking the 75th anniversary of the UN.

  The event was held under the theme “The Future We Want, the UN We Need: Reaffirming our Collective Commitment to Multilateralism” while the theme of the session was “The future we want, the United Nations we need, reaffirming our collective commitment to multilateralism – confronting the COVID-19 through effective multilateral action”.

 

4. GOI’S WMA LIMIT

  The Reserve Bank of India (RBI), in consultation with the Government of India (GoI) has fixed Rs 1,25,000 crore as the Ways and Means Advances (WMA) limit for the 2nd half of the financial year(FY) 2020-21, i.e., October 2020 to March 2021.

  The interest rate on WMA is equal to the repo rate(current repo rate is 4%).

  In case of overdraft, the interest rate is 2% above the repo rate.

 

5. RBI EXCLUDES 6 PSBS FROM SECOND SCHEDULE OF RBI ACT

  Reserve Bank of India (RBI) excluded six public sector banks (PSBs) from the Second Schedule of the RBI Act, 1934 following their merger with other banks with effect from April 01, 2020.

  The six banks are Syndicate Bank, Oriental Bank of Commerce (OBC), United Bank of India, Andhra Bank, Corporation Bank, and Allahabad Bank.

  OBC and United Bank of India merged into Punjab National Bank; Syndicate Bank into Canara Bank; Andhra Bank and Corporation Bank into Union Bank of India; and Allahabad Bank into Indian Bank.

 

6. INTERNATIONAL DAY OF OLDER PERSONS 2020 – OCTOBER 1

  UN’s International Day of Older Persons is annually observed across the globe on 1st October to recognise the elderlys as an asset to the society who are capable of contributing to the development process.

  The 1st October 2020 marks the 30th Anniversary of the International Day of Older Persons.

  The theme of the International Day of Older Persons 2020 is “Pandemics: Do They Change How We Address Age and Ageing?”.

 

7. INTERNATIONAL COFFEE DAY 2020: OCTOBER 1

  International Coffee Day is observed annually on October 1 to celebrate coffee and recognize the efforts of people who are associated with the coffee industry namely,  farmers, roasters, baristas, coffee shop owners globally.

  The day also promotes fair trade coffee and to raise awareness for the coffee growers

  International Coffee Organisation (ICO) launched its first official International Coffee Day in Milan, Italy  in 2015 as part of Expo 2015, a World Expo hosted by Milan.

 

8. WORLD VEGETARIAN DAY OBSERVED ON OCTOBER 1, 2020

  World Vegetarian Day is celebrated annually on October 1.

  It is observed to promote Joy, Compassion and life-enhancing possibilities of Vegetarianism.

  The World Vegetarian Day was founded in 1977 by North American Vegetarian Society (NAVS), and endorsed by International Vegetarian Union in 1978.
